Artificial Intelligence-AI K-12 CURRICULUM PROGRAMME
PRINCIPALS ORIENTATION WORKSHOP
Date:11th Sept,2019  Venue: Springdales School ,Pusa Road


The Workshop began with the Inaugural Address by the CBSE Chairperson ,Mrs Anita Karwal  who talked about the CBSE initiative of  introducing  AI as a step towards Experiential Learning .

This endeavour would help to unleash the explorative and creative nature of children and prepare them for the 21st Century Skills that will prepare them for global citizenship.

Artificial Intelligence has been introduced as a subject from Grade VIII
this year and the learning modules, flip and e modules will be available
soon on the official website. Making AI an integral part of the curriculum
through interdisciplinary projects is the vision ahead and support from all
stake holders is required to take it forward. Introducing design thinking
as a subject would be the next step.

The IBM Project Head was the second speaker who apprised all about how machine learning had started in the year 1800 but has now taken the world by its stride.

AI introduction would work on three areas, knowledge, skills and values that are required to introduce good technology. A collaborative approach that builds goodwill would be the focus and as children have an abundance of ideas reverse mentoring will happen and new apps can be launched for productive disruptions,    and re -skilling that is the need of the hour for producing a future skill proof generation.

Other sessions followed with the trainers who took the delegates through the AI learning and its use in every field and the implication it has in our day to day lives.

The workshop was enriching, inspiring the leaders to take on technology
as a way of life and condense it with the school eco system.
